APC Expels Aregbesola Over Anti-party Activities

January 30, 2025
Rauf Aregbesola

Former Minister of Interior and Osun State Governor, Rauf Aregbesola, has been expelled by the All Progressives Congress (APC).

The party claimed that it found allegations of anti-party activities against Aregbesola to be true.

This was confirmed in a letter from APC titled, ‘Allegations of anti-party activities—conveyance of state exco decision to you’.

The letter dated 7 January 2025, said Aregbesola had violated Article 21 of the APC constitution, which stipulates disciplinary measures for members.

Aregbesola served as governor of Osun State for two terms from 2010 to 2018 and Minister of Interior in the second tenure of former President Muhammadu Buhari from 2019 to 2023.

The statement said the State Executive Committee (SEC) resolved to approve the former minister’s immediate expulsion from the APC.

“This decision was based on clear evidence of actions that undermined the unity and integrity of the party. Consequently, you are no longer a member of the APC and must refrain from representing or acting on behalf of the party in any capacity.”

The governor led The Osun Progressives, a faction within the APC that was later renamed the Omoluabi Progressives.

The expulsion came few days after Omoluabi announced its decision to dump the APC over declining influence of the party in Osun State.

The group in a statement by its Organising and Publicity Secretary, Oluwaseun Abosede said Aregbesola commended their move, adding that it is necessary to enable Omoluabi Progressives members realised the group’s  vision to entrench good governance in Osun State.
